Bulut Bilişim ile Altyapı nizi Düşürün Arden Agopyan Client Technical Professional Lead WebSphere Application Infrastructure IBM Central & Eastern Europe, Middle East & Africa 2009 IBM Corporation Gündem Bulut Bilişimi Neden bulut bilişimi? Dünden bugüne sistem mimarileri Bulut modelleri IBM ve bulut bilişimi Kurumsal Uygulama Bulutları ve WebSphere Soru & Cevap 2 2009 IBM Corporation 1
BT Artıyor Değişim için motivasyon Sistemleri yönetme maliyetleri 2000 yılından bu yana iki kat arttı Sistemlere güç ve soğutma sağlama maliyetleri 2000 yılından bu yana iki kat arttı Ağlar üzerinden veriye erişen aygıt sayısı her 2,5 yılda iki kat artıyor Tüketilen bant genişliği her 1,5 yılda iki kat artıyor Veriler her 18 ayda iki kat artıyor 1 Sunucu işlem kapasitesi her 3 yılda iki kat artıyor 2 10G Ethernet portlarının sayısı gelecek 5 yıl içinde üç kat artacak Harcama (ABD$Milyar) $300 $250 $200 $150 $100 $50 $0 1996 Güç ve soğutma maliyetleri Sunucu yönetimi ve sistem yöneticisi maliyetleri Yeni sunucu harcaması Kurulu Taban (Milyon Birim) 1997 1998 1999 2000 2001 2002 2003 2004 2005 2006 2007 2008 2009 2010 Kaynak: IDC, 2008 1 Dünya Çapında Kurumsal Disk Depolama Sistemleri Üzerinde Sevk Edilen TB Kapasitesi 2 Tüketilen sunucu işleme kapasitesi her 3 yılda iki kat artıyor 3 2009 IBM Corporation 50 45 40 35 30 25 20 15 10 5 0 Bugünkü BT alt yapısında... Yeni bir uygulamanın çalışır duruma getirilmesi için gerekli olan ortalama süre 4-6 haftadır Onaylar, satın alma, sevkiyat, donanım kurulumu, lisans satın alınması, işletim sistemi kurulumu, uygulama kurulumu, yapılandırma Hataların %30'u tutarlı olmayan yapılandırmalardan kaynaklanır Bu hatalar genellikle belirlenmesi en zor olan türdür Bunlar genellikle geliştirme/test, kalite güvence, üretim arasındaki geçiş sırasında ortaya çıkar Bir ortam oluşturulması çok pahalı olduğundan, gerek kalmamasına rağmen, "her ihtimale karşı" ortamların elde tutulmasına yönelik bir eğilim bulunmaktadır. Geleceğin ortamları = iade edilen donanımın geri kazanılması yerine yeni donanım; bu da zaman ve para gerektirir 4 2009 IBM Corporation 2
Bulut Bilişimi Öncekilerin üstüne yenilikçi bir model Bulut sistemleri bilgi teknolojisi (BT) endüstrisini dönüştürecektir... kişilerin ve şirketlerin çalışma şeklini kökten değiştirecektir." Ortamınızın içinden veya dışından bir hizmet olarak sağlanan dinamik ve ölçeklenebilir bilgi işlem kaynaklarıdır. 2009 Bulut" ortamında bulunan kaynaklardan herhangi birine, ağı kullanarak her zaman ve her yerden erişebilirsiniz. Sağlayıcı, kullanımınızı takip edebilir Sanallaştırma ve ücretlendirebilir. Hizmet Olarak Yazılım (SaaS) 1990 Utility Computing Grid Computing Bulut Bilişimi imi 5 2009 IBM Corporation Bulut Bilişimi Katmanları Đş Süreçleri Đşbirliği Sektör Uygulamaları Hizmet Olarak Yazılım(SaaS) MĐY/ERP/ĐK Ara Katman Yazılımı Yüksek Hacimli İşlemler Veritabanı Web 2.0 Uygulama Runtime Geliştirme Araçları Java Runtime Hizmet Olarak Platform(PaaS) Veri Merkezi Sunucular Ağ Oluşturma Depolama Yöneltme Yapısı Paylaşılan, sanallaştırılmış, dinamik sağlama Hizmet Olarak Altyapı(IaaS) 6 2009 IBM Corporation 3
IBM'in Cloud Laboratuvarları Tüm Dünyadaki Müşterileri Destekliyor Teknoloji Geliştirme, Müşterilerle Đlişkiler, Pazar Deneyimi Silikon Vadisi California Raleigh North Carolina Dublin İrlanda Doha Katar Pekin Çin Seul Güney Kore Wuxi Çin Tokyo Japonya Bangalore Hindistan Hanoi Vietnam São Paulo Brezilya Johannesburg Güney Afrika 7 2009 IBM Corporation www.ibm.com/cloud Always connected, always on. 8 2009 IBM Corporation 4
www.ibm.com/developerworks/spaces/cloud Developer Cloud Space 9 2009 IBM Corporation WebSphere akıllı yönetim çözümleri ve uygulama altyapısını iyileştirme Sanallaştırılmış Uygulamalar ve Bilgi Đşlem Ortamları Daha Düşük Đşletim ve Enerji Daha Fazla Esneklik Altyapının Proaktif Yönetimi WebSphere ve Bulutlar: WebSphere Hypervisor Edition WebSphere CloudBurst Appliance 10 2009 IBM Corporation 5
Uygulama ve Platformlar Application Hardware, Operating System, Database, Network, Storage Application Other Hardware, Operating System, Database, Network, Storage 11 2009 IBM Corporation Platform Bağımsızlık Application Platform A Platform B 12 2009 IBM Corporation 6
Workload Management & High Availability Application Server Second Server 13 2009 IBM Corporation Sunucu Yığınları CRM Logistics System A Hardware, Resources, Hardware, Memory, Resources, Storage, Memory, Networking... Storage, Networking... System B Hardware, Resources, Hardware, Memory, Resources, Storage, Hardware, Memory, Networking... Resources, Storage, Memory, Networking... Storage, Networking... 14 2009 IBM Corporation 7
Sunucu Sanallaştırma CRM Logistics System A System B Hypervisor Hardware, Resources, Memory, Storage, Networking... 15 2009 IBM Corporation Uygulama Sanallaştırma CRM Logistics ERP Commerce... Application Virtualization / Intelligent Management System A Hardware, Resources, Hardware, Memory, Resources, Storage, Memory, Networking... Storage, Networking... System B Hardware, Resources, Hardware, Memory, Resources, Storage, Hardware, Memory, Networking... Resources, Storage, Memory, Networking... Storage, Networking... 16 2009 IBM Corporation 8
Sunucu ve Uygulama Sanallaştırma Birlikte daha güçlü... CRM Logistics ERP Commerce Application Virtualization / Intelligent Management App Server App Server App Server DEV/TEST App Server System A System B System C System D Hypervisor CLOUD Hypervisor Hardware, Resources, Memory, Storage, Networking... Hardware, Resources, Memory, Storage, Networking... 17 2009 IBM Corporation Kaynak Optimizasyonu: Bir Örnek: Şirketin Mevcut Sunucu Kullanımı Cluster 1 Cluster 2 Cluster 3 %20 Kullanılan Sunucular %15 Kullanılan Sunucular %10 Kullanılan Sunucular Konut Kredisi Đşlemleri Kredi Kartı Đşlemleri Mevduat / Vadeli Hesap Đşlemleri 18 2009 IBM Corporation 9
Kaynak Optimizasyonu : Bir Örnek: Yeni tanıtım, kredi taleplerinde büyük artışa neden olur... Cluster 1 Cluster 2 Cluster 3 %75 Kullanılan Sunucular Tüketici Kredisi Đşlemleri Kredi Đşleme Süresi: %15 hedefin üzerinde Müşteri şikayetleri: %25 hedefin üzerinde CSR Verimi: %30 hedefin altında Tanıtım, sunucu kullanımını %100'e %15 Kullanılan Sunucular çıkarır Kredi Kartı Đşlemleri %10 Kullanılan Sunucular Mevduat / Vadeli Hesap Đşlemleri 19 2009 Canlandırma IBM Corporation Kaynak Optimizasyonu : Bir Örnek: WCA, konut kredisi işleme uygulamasının yüksek düzeyde önceliğe sahip olduğunu belirler... Cluster 1 Cluster 2 Cluster 3 %75 Kullanılan Sunucular Tüketici Kredisi Đşlemleri Tanıtım, sunucu kullanımını %100'e çıkarır %50 Kullanılan Sunucular %40 Kullanılan Sunucular Kredi Kartı Đşlemleri Mevduat / Vadeli Hesap Đşlemleri 20 2009 Canlandırma IBM Corporation 10
Kaynak Optimizasyonu : Bir Örnek: WebSphere CloudBurst, kullanımı en yüksek düzeye çıkartır ve tepki vermeyi hızlandırır! Cluster 1 Küme 2 Cluster 3 Tek Kaynak Havuzu %55* Kullanılan Sunucular Talep Đşlemleri Altın Hesap Yönetimi Gümüş Fatura Uygulaması Bronz Müşteri Desteği Altın Sigortacılık Gümüş * Sadece bilgilendirme amaçlı olarak, kuramsal 21 2009 IBM Corporation WebSphere CloudBurst ortamı: 2 ana ürün 1) WebSphere CloudBurst Appliance (Hardware) 2) (Image Software) 2) CloudBurst, WebSphere Hypervisor Edition Sunucularını bir dizi başka makineye dağıtır WebSphere Application Server IHS 1) Kullanıcı, WebSphere Application Server Hypervisor Edition Ortamının dağıtılmasını talep eder 3) Kullanıcı WebSphere Application Server Hypervisor Edition Sunucularına (Image) erişebilir Özelleştirme / Bağlantı işlevi Đşletim Sistemi WebSphere CloudBurst aygıtı bu sanal görünümleri özel bir bulut ortamına dağıtır 22 2009 IBM Corporation 11
WebSphere HyperVisor Edition () WAS, hypervisor üzerinde yürütülmeye hazır olarak sevk edilir Imaj, tek sunucu veya cluster destekleyebilir WAS v6.1 ve v7 genel kullanıma sunulmuştur WebSphere Application Server IHS Hem WAS hem de Đşletim Sistemi için IBM üzerinden bakım, feature pack ve fixpack dağıtımı! OVF standardı tabanlı Özelleştirme / Bağlantı işlevi Đşletim Sistemi Multi-Platform: Linux (SuSe, RedHat) AIX z/os 23 2009 IBM Corporation Hypervisor Desteği PowerVM 64 bit AIX Đşletim Sistemi üzerinde 64 bit WebSphere desteği VMware ESX 4.0 (vsphere) ESX 3.0.2, 3.0.3, 3.5 ESXi (ücretsiz yükleme) artık desteklenmemektedir VMware vcenter isteğe bağlı olarak kullanılabilir Bazı kısıtlamalar mevcuttur z/vm (V2.0'de yeni) Çok sayıda hypervisor platformunun yönetilmesi için tek aygıt kullanılabilir 24 2009 IBM Corporation 12
Imaj Desteği WebSphere Hypervisor Edition DB2 Enterprise Edition WebSphere Portal WebSphere Process Server WebSphere Message Broker (yeni) WebSphere Business Monitor (yeni) 25 2009 IBM Corporation Uygulama Sanallaştırma: Intelligent Management Pack WCA Intelligent Management Pack, uygulama sanallaştırma ve kaynak optimizasyonu işlevleri içerir Üretim sunucularını WebSphere CloudBurst Appliance uygulamasına açar Uygulama altyapısının devreye alınmasını ve yönetilmesini basitleştirmek için birlikte kullanılabilir. 26 2009 IBM Corporation 13
WebSphere CloudBurst kullanımı: Temel adımlar 1. Cloud ortamını tanımlayın 2. Sanal görünümleri düzenleyin 3. Script paketleri ekleyin 4. Desenleri özelleştirin (Patterns) 5. Sanal sistemleri dağıtın 27 2009 IBM Corporation IBM CloudBurst ve WebSphere CloudBurst? 28 2009 IBM Corporation 14
Toplam Sahip Olma Maliyeti Analizi WS CloudBurst olmadan WS CloudBurst ile %100 Yeni Yeni Geliştirme Geliştirme Yazılım Yazılım Yeni Yeni Geliştirme Geliştirme Stratejik Değişiklik Kapasitesi Mevcut BT Harcaması Güç Güç Emek Emek (Đşletim (Đşletim ve ve Bakım) Bakım) Donanım Donanım (yıllık) (yıllık) Devreye Devreye Alma Alma (1-süre) (1-süre) Yazılım Yazılım Güç Güç Emek Emek Donanım Donanım %xx daha düşük yıllık işletim maliyeti 29 2009 IBM Corporation WAS + WCA Intelligent Management Pack = WebSphere Bulutları WebSphere Cloudburst Appliance 30 2009 IBM Corporation 15
www.ardenagopyan.com 31 2009 IBM Corporation Teşekkürler! Sorular? Arden Agopyan Client Technical Professional Lead Application Infrastructure, CEEMEA IBM Türk Limited şirketi Büyükdere Caddesi Levent, 34330 Đstanbul Tel/Faks: 0212 317 11 00 e-mail: arden@tr.ibm.com blog: http://www.ardenagopyan.com 32 2009 IBM Corporation 16